Description
Job Purpose and ImpactThe Demand Supply Planning Lead, SEA will lead and provide directions to supervisors and analysts, overseeing all day-to-day supply chain activities across a country or single site operation. In this role, you will design, propose and implement logistic and supply chain strategies, guidelines and procedures to meet requirements supporting short- and long-term business needs.
Key Accountabilities
- Participate in selection of direct reports and other employees.
- Reconcile and review supply and demand calculations for a medium or small team and evaluate moderately complex analyses of the data.
- Collaborate with our team to handle key contacts within the commercial team, operations, and Cargill Transportation & Logistics.
- Participate in a country or single-site team to construct forecasting, demand planning and allocation planning for a tactical outlook.
- Provide general oversight, guidance and integration of multiple areas in the Cargill supply chain such as customer service, supply chain planning, strategic sourcing/procurement, plant operations, and transportation and logistics.
- Lead and develop a team, coach and make decisions related to talent management, hiring, performance, and disciplinary actions.
- Other duties as assigned
Qualifications
Minimum Qualifications
- Minimum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in a related field or equivalent experience
- Minimum of 8 years of Supply & Demand planning experience in FMCG / Manufacturing
- Minimum of 6 years' experience dealing with SEA market
- Experience in implementation of digital tools
- Experience in managing a team
Preferred Qualifications- Experience with SAP tools
